> On 18/11/2013, at 11:52, Luca Ciciriello <[email protected]> wrote:
> 
>> Trying to compile a .pl file on Mavericks I got this error:
>> 
>> "error trying to execute /opt/local/bingcc-apple-4.2: No such file or directory."
> 
> Why is the slash between "bin" and "gcc-apple-4.2" missing? Odd.
> 
>> I’ve Xcode 5.x installed and I know that gcc is no longer available in OS X.
>> 
>> Any idea?
> 
> Not sure about why you're getting the error above but you can install that gcc version using MacPorts by typing:
> 
> $ sudo port install apple-gcc42
